Questo articolo descrive un protocollo passo-passo per impostare un modello suino ex vivo di cheratite batterica. Pseudomonas aeruginosa è usato come organismo prototipico. Questo modello innovativo imita l'infezione in vivo in quanto la proliferazione batterica dipende dalla capacità del batterio di danneggiare il tessuto corneale.
